Solution for 8-8a=2(2+-6a) equation:



8-8a=2(2+-6a)
We move all terms to the left:
8-8a-(2(2+-6a))=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
-8a-(2(-6a))+8=0
We calculate terms in parentheses: -(2(-6a)), so:
2(-6a)
We multiply parentheses
-12a
Back to the equation:
-(-12a)
We get rid of parentheses
-8a+12a+8=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
4a+8=0
We move all terms containing a to the left, all other terms to the right
4a=-8
a=-8/4
a=-2
